Aging causes our skin to lose elasticity and fat resulting in the formation of lines, wrinkles and folds in the areas that we use frequently. Although there are many procedures that will dramatically lift and tighten your face, you may want to go with the less invasive options for wrinkle removal.
Injectable fillers are a great option for non-surgical and minimally invasive wrinkle reduction. Today there are many injectables available on the market, but the most popular, longest standing option is collagen. Collagen injections are used to treat these visible signs of aging by replacing some of the natural collagen and fat in the dermis with a surrogate collagen.
Collagen fillers can correct:
- Nasolabial folds (parentheses lines)
- Frown lines
- Crow’s feet
- Scars
- Thin or thinning lips
- Wrinkles around the lips (vermilion border wrinkles)
Collagen fillers come in two different types: human or mammal-based. It is important that you not have any allergies to bovine products or lidocaine if you are considering collagen injections. Additionally, you should not be pregnant, nursing or have any autoimmune conditions.
The Collagen Filler Procedure
You and Tampa Cosmetic Surgeon Dr. Jasin will discuss the various options available for your procedure. You may choose from a variety of different collagen formulas such as Cosmoderm®, Cosmoplast®, Zyderm® and Zyplast® depending upon the amount of correction you need and the type of collagen you wish to have. With bovine formulas, you will have to undergo an allergy test before your procedure.
On the day of your procedure, Dr. Jasin will disinfect the area to be treated and possibly numb it topically. He will then inject about three to five needles full of a collagen/lidocaine mixture. The lidocaine numbs the injection site while the collagen fills. A basic collagen injection procedure can take anywhere from fifteen minutes to one hour depending on the extent of correction.
Postoperative Considerations
Some minor swelling and sensitivity may occur after treatment. Any scabbing should subside after two to three days. You should be able to return to your normal activities almost immediately following your treatment.
Collagen treatment therapy produces noticeable lightening of scarring and wrinkles that can last up to six months. This is caused by your body slowly metabolizing the injected collagen, returning to its previous state. To maintain your results, you should consider having collagen injections performed every three to six months.
